How many constructive speeches should each team have in terms of Musgrave?​
Alex787 [66]

Answer:

In high school, all four constructive speeches are generally eight minutes long and all four rebuttal speeches are four or five minutes in length depending on the region; in college they are nine and six minutes long respectively. All cross-examination periods are three minutes long in high school and in college.
